Summary
Columbia caps residential collection at one garbage pickup and one trash pickup per week under City Code § 19-40. Households in a designated recycling area get a combined garbage-and-recyclables collection plus one trash collection, the same one-plus-one weekly structure.
Except in those areas designated by the city for the recycling of recyclable materials, not more than one garbage collection and one trash collection shall be provided per week for residential property. In those areas designated by the city for the recycling of recyclable materials, one garbage and recyclable materials collection and one trash collection shall be provided per week for residential property.

Full Breakdown
Section 19-40 sets the frequency ceiling for residential service directly: "Except in those areas designated by the city for the recycling of recyclable materials, not more than one garbage collection and one trash collection shall be provided per week for residential property. In those areas designated by the city for the recycling of recyclable materials, one garbage and recyclable materials collection and one trash collection shall be provided per week for residential property." In both cases residential property gets exactly two weekly pickups, one for garbage (combined with recyclables where the program operates) and one for trash.
That schedule sits on top of the mandatory service structure the rest of Chapter 19 builds: § 19-32 puts collection under the director of public services, § 19-34 requires occupants to remove non-household waste and packing materials themselves rather than waiting on the weekly route, and § 19-38 makes it unlawful to bring refuse generated outside the city in for collection by city crews, so the weekly allotment is reserved for waste actually produced within Columbia. Service itself is largely free for residential customers under § 19-43, which lists 'no charge' for single-family or multifamily buildings of six units or fewer subject to ad valorem tax, while tax-exempt residential property is billed $175.00 per year for the same weekly schedule.
Violations & Fines
Exceeding the weekly collection allotment by setting out excess material without following the § 19-37 excess-waste and bulky-item procedures, or bringing in refuse from outside the city in violation of § 19-38, is a misdemeanor under § 19-33, punishable by up to $500.00 or 30 days' imprisonment under the Code's general penalty section, § 1-5.
